Lithops plants are intriguing succulents native to the arid regions of southern Africa. These low-maintenance plants have evolved to closely resemble rocks or pebbles, allowing them to blend seamlessly into their natural surroundings. Their ability to camouflage is truly remarkable, as they mimic the texture, color, and patterns of the rocks they inhabit.

They absorb nutrients from old leaves and eventually make their way through the fissure. Some Lithops may grow new leaves without flowering, which is often due to their early growing cycle.

To determine if your Lithops are growing new leaves, check their leaves for squishiness and softness. If they feel squishy and soft, it's likely that the outer leaves are at the shredding stage. New leaves will emerge after a few days, and it's important not to water them until the old leaves completely wither.

From the late spring - early summer and late summer - early fall, during the active growing season, you can water your lithops every 2-3 weeks. However, it's crucial to ensure that the soil is completely dry before watering again.
